Output fba3084dee188f12b91f6c0563a19de88524d1ce5fafdad68b9b21f402e78ae4:0

value
228553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cead1496d25c63ea1c59ea50f92f5ed74e249c2 OP_EQUAL
address
3FzidspkJXpwCnmJbPJjgo2HzhKC6jda9d
transaction
fba3084dee188f12b91f6c0563a19de88524d1ce5fafdad68b9b21f402e78ae4
spent
true